Home/Memos/Resources

The Definitive Guide to Resource Allocation in the Software and Hi-Tech Industries (2026)

By Krezzo·Verified February 24, 2026

The Definitive Guide to Resource Allocation in the Software and Hi-Tech Industries (2026)

Quick Answer: Effective resource allocation in the software and hi-tech industries involves strategically distributing personnel and assets based on skills, availability, and project requirements. This optimization minimizes waste and enhances productivity, ultimately driving project success.

At a Glance

  • Resource Allocation Efficiency: Proper allocation can increase project delivery speed by up to 30%.
  • Cost Reduction: Effective resource management can reduce operational costs by as much as 25%.
  • Skill Utilization: Aligning tasks with employee skill sets can lead to a 40% increase in team productivity.
  • Project Success Rates: Companies that implement structured resource allocation strategies see a 50% higher success rate in project completion.
  • Time Savings: Streamlined resource allocation processes can save up to 15 hours per week per project manager.
  • Employee Satisfaction: Properly allocated resources can enhance employee satisfaction and retention rates by up to 20%.

Understanding Resource Allocation in Software and Hi-Tech

Resource Allocation refers to the strategic distribution of resources—such as personnel, technology, and financial assets—to maximize efficiency and effectiveness in project execution. In the software and hi-tech industries, effective resource allocation is critical due to the fast-paced nature of projects and the need for specialized skills.

The Importance of Effective Resource Allocation

The software and hi-tech sectors are characterized by rapid innovation, tight deadlines, and complex project requirements. Effective resource allocation ensures that the right skills are matched with the right tasks, which is essential for meeting project goals and deadlines. Moreover, it helps organizations avoid common pitfalls such as project delays, budget overruns, and employee burnout.

Key Challenges in Resource Allocation

  1. Skill Gaps and Availability: Identifying the right talent with the necessary skills can be challenging, especially in a competitive job market.
  2. Tracking Billable Hours: Accurately monitoring the time spent on projects can be difficult, leading to potential revenue losses.
  3. Balancing Workloads: Ensuring that team members are neither overworked nor underutilized requires careful planning and monitoring.
  4. Integration of Tools: Many organizations struggle with disparate systems that do not communicate effectively, hindering resource management.

Best Practices for Resource Allocation

1. Assess Resource Availability and Skills

Conduct a thorough assessment of your team's skills and availability. This involves:

  • Skill Inventory: Create a database of employee skills, certifications, and experiences.
  • Availability Tracking: Use project management tools to monitor team members' workloads and availability.

2. Implement a Resource Management Tool

Utilize integrated resource management software that provides real-time visibility into resource allocation. These tools can help with:

  • Automated Tracking: Automatically track billable hours and project progress.
  • Workload Balancing: Visualize team workloads to ensure balanced distribution of tasks.

3. Establish Clear Communication Channels

Ensure that there is open communication among team members and project managers. This can include:

  • Regular Check-ins: Schedule weekly meetings to discuss project status and resource needs.
  • Feedback Mechanisms: Implement channels for team members to provide feedback on workload and resource allocation.

4. Monitor and Adjust Resources Continuously

Resource allocation should not be static. Regularly review and adjust allocations based on project developments and team performance. Consider:

  • Performance Metrics: Use KPIs to evaluate project success and team productivity.
  • Flexibility: Be ready to reallocate resources as project needs change.

Real-World Case Study: Successful Resource Allocation

A leading software development firm implemented a structured resource allocation strategy that involved:

  • Skill Mapping: They assessed their team’s skills and created a detailed skill matrix.
  • Resource Management Software: The firm adopted an AI-powered resource management tool that enabled real-time tracking of project progress and team availability.

As a result, they achieved a 30% increase in project delivery speed and a 25% reduction in operational costs within six months. Employee satisfaction also improved, leading to a 20% reduction in turnover rates.

Frequently Asked Questions

What is resource allocation?

Resource allocation is the process of distributing available resources—such as personnel, technology, and finances—effectively across various projects to maximize efficiency and achieve organizational goals.

How does resource allocation work?

Resource allocation works by assessing the skills and availability of team members, then strategically assigning them to projects based on their expertise and the project's requirements. This may involve using specialized software tools for tracking and management.

Why is resource allocation important?

Effective resource allocation is crucial for ensuring that projects are completed on time and within budget. It helps prevent resource wastage, optimizes team productivity, and enhances overall project success rates.

How much does resource allocation software cost?

The cost of resource allocation software can vary widely depending on the features and scale of the tool. Basic tools may start at around $10 per user per month, while more comprehensive solutions can range from $50 to several hundred dollars per user per month.

Key Takeaways

  • Resource allocation is essential for maximizing efficiency in the software and hi-tech industries.
  • Implementing best practices, such as skill assessments and utilizing resource management tools, can significantly enhance project outcomes.
  • Continuous monitoring and adjustment of resource allocation strategies are vital to adapt to changing project demands.

Sources

  • "The Impact of Resource Allocation on Project Delivery," Project Management Institute, 2025.
  • "Optimizing Resource Management in Software Development," Harvard Business Review, 2026.
  • "Workforce Productivity in the Tech Industry," TechCrunch, 2026.

Related Reading

  • The Definitive Guide to OKR Implementation and Management in 2026
  • The Comprehensive Guide to Product Return Policies in 2026
  • The Definitive Guide to Video Conferencing and Collaboration Tools in 2026
  • The Complete Guide to AI-Powered Productivity Tools in 2026